Top 5 Hybridcasual Games on iOS in Nigeria - Q3 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 hybridcasual games on iOS in Nigeria during Q3 2023,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2023, the performance of the top 5 hybridcasual games on iOS in Nigeria showed notable tr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here is a detailed look at how these games fared:
Survivor!.io by HABBY saw an interesting fluctuation in its weekly revenue, which peaked at around $679 in mid-August. Weekly downloads experienced a decline from 350 in late June to a low of 68 by late August, before slightly recovering to 306 by the end of September. The game’s weekly active users followed a similar trend, peaking at 1.5K in late June and gradually decreasing to around 1K in early September, with a slight uptick to 1.3K by the end of the quarter.
Triple Match 3D from Boombox Games LTD had a more stable performance in terms of revenue, with a peak of $192 in mid-August. Weekly downloads saw significant growth, starting at 121 in late June and reaching 364 by the end of August, before stabilizing around 141 by the end of September. Active users showed a steady increase, peaking at 705 in late August and then slightly declining to 586 by the end of the quarter.
DEAD TARGET: FPS Zombie Games by VNG Game Studios experienced a substantial rise in weekly downloads, growing from 448 in late June to a high of 7K by mid-August, before dropping to 3.2K by the end of September. Revenue peaked at $133 in late August, while active users saw a significant increase, peaking at 25K in late August and maintaining around 21K by the end of September.
Sniper 3D: Gun Shooting Games from Wildlife Studios showed a consistent performance in weekly downloads, averaging around 2K throughout the quarter. Revenue peaked at $100 in mid-August. Active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 22K in late July and maintaining around 20K by the end of September.
Archero by HABBY had a modest performance with its weekly revenue peaking at $299 in early July. Downloads saw an increase, peaking at 116 in early August. Active users showed a steady trend, peaking at 588 in early August and slightly decreasing to around 509 by the end of September.
